Eugene, OR: Aster Publishing, July 1998. Wrappers, 8 &1/2" x 11". This issue contains articles on book canvasers in America, Ambrose Bierce, pulp fiction art, Sir Max Beerbohm and Zuleika Dobson, and Kenny's Bookshop. Contributors include Nicholas Basbanes. As new..
